A $54 foundation that promises lightweight but long-lasting coverage has been named the best in Australia by thousands of women.
Estee Lauder’s Double Wear Light Stay-In-Place Makeup SPF 10 beat out stiff competition from big-name brands including Clinique to be named best new foundation at the 2022 BeautyHeaven Glosscar Awards.
The product – which gives a flawless, natural and matte finish – is sold in a staggering 60 shades and promises ’24-hour staying power’.

The foundation is sweat and humidity resistant, non-creasing or streaking and dermatologist-approved.

Product description online says it is ‘fresh, natural, healthy and even-toned’, and it hydrates the skin while also concealing any blemishes, redness and pigmentation.
To discover which Estee Lauder shade best suits your skin, the brand recommends you look at the undertones in your complexion.
If your bare skin has a rosy tone and burns easily in the sun, you likely have a Cool (C) undertone.
Meanwhile if your bare skin is more even-toned without being too pink or golden, you likely have Neutral (N) undertones.
Finally, if your bare skin has a golden or olive tone and it tans easily in the sun, you have a Warm (W) undertone.
Once you know your undertone, simply narrow down your intensity level (from light to deep) and you should find your perfect shade.

Those who swear by the foundation praise the fact that it makes the skin look glowy and fresh for hours on end.
Online, Double Wear Light boasts more than 9,000 five-star reviews, where women alternately describe it as ‘beautiful’, ‘flawless’, ‘luminous’ and ‘amazing’.
‘This glides on smooth and silky! My favorite part is it didn’t clump into fine lines, and stayed a perfect finish throughout a whole work day without even having to touch up!’ one reviewer posted.
‘The makeup was smooth and felt lightweight! It blended really well to my skin and it feels good, like I’m not wearing any makeup!’ another reviewer added.
A third wrote: ‘I’ve never had a foundation that truly matched my skin tone like this! It went on so smoothly and the coverage is great. It feels light on the skin. HIGHLY recommend’.

It’s not just beauty devotees who swear by the Estee Lauder foundation, either.
Countless flight attendants wrote that it is their hero makeup product thanks to the fact that it offers full coverage and lasting radiance.
‘The environment I work in is quite drying so it is important for me to have a hydrating skin routine and hydrating primer underneath,’ one air hostess posted.
Others drew attention to the fact that the foundation is ‘good value for money’ when you compare it to other high-end foundations.
The runner-up in the best new foundation category was Clinique Even Better Clinical Serum Foundation SPF20.
